Tīmeklis2024. gada 11. aug. · In this paper, we present a paleomagnetic direction of Oligocene age from the Kyushu-Palau ridge in the PHS plate (Fig. 1), and discuss its rotation. The Kyushu-Palau ridge is a remnant arc, which was active from ~ 48 to 25 Ma before the opening of the Shikoku and Parece-Vela basins (Ishizuka et al. 2011). Tīmeklis1984. gada 20. febr. · The Kyushu-Palau Ridge (KPR) is a remnant arc that initially formed with the subduction of the Pacific plate beneath the West Philippine Sea. The KPR split from the proto-Izu-Bonin-Mariana (IBM) arc with the back-arc spreading at ∼ 30 Ma.
